The vowel pair AA (from Dutch) is an umlaut A as it is usually paired with an R.
The vowel pair OO has short and long sounds (good, foot / cool, moon).
The vowel pair EE is almost always long E. (it sounds like a short I in been)
Two I's together (e.g. radii) are pronounced separately as a long E and long I.
The vowels U and Y are never double vowels.
